AN ACT ESTABLISHING THE CRIME OF HARMFUL 
COMMUNICATION WITH A MINOR. 
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ives in General 
Assembly convened: 
 
Section 1. (NEW) (Effective October 1, 2023) (a) As used in this section: 1 
(1) "Minor" means any person under eighteen years of age, or who 2 
the actor reasonably believes to be under eighteen years of age; 3 
(2) "Interactive computer service" has the same meaning as provided 4 
in section 53a-90a of the general statutes; 5 
(3) "Inappropriate relationship" means a relationship that is patently 6 
offensive to prevailing standards in the adult community as a whole 7 
with respect to what is a suitable relationship between an adult and a 8 
minor; and 9 
(4) "Harmful to the minor" means communication with a minor that 10 
is patently offensive to prevailing standards in the adult community as 11 
a whole with respect to what is a suitable form of communication 12 
between an adult and a minor. 13  Raised Bill No.  6737

(b) A person, who is twenty-one years of age or older, is guilty of 14 
harmful communication with a minor when such person uses an 15 
interactive computer service or text message to knowingly persuade, 16 
induce, entice or coerce a minor, to: (1) Share a photographic or other 17 
recorded image of the minor for the purpose of providing sexual 18 
gratification to the person who requests that the image be shared, (2) 19 
share a photographic or other recorded image of the minor, which the 20 
person who requests the image then disseminates to one or more third 21 
persons for the purpose of providing sexual gratification to such third 22 
persons, (3) engage in any communication that is part of a pattern of 23 
communication or behavior designed to form or maintain an 24 
inappropriate relationship, or (4) engage in any communication that is 25 
harmful to the minor. 26 
(c) For the purposes of this section, a violation may be deemed to have 27 
been committed either at the place where the communication originated 28 
or at the place where it was received. 29 
(d) Harmful communication with a minor is a class A misdemeanor. 30 
This act shall take effect as follows and shall amend the following 
sections: 
 
Section 1 October 1, 2023 New section 
 
Statement of Purpose:   
To establish the crime of harmful communication with a minor.
